How to Reset Dungeons in Diablo 4

Reset Dungeon button in Diablo IV

The Dungeons are one of the best places to farm loot such as weapons, armor, and gold. To help players, Diablo 4 allows you to reset them and explore them again for more loot.

To reset the Dungeons in Diablo 4, you’ll have to follow these simple steps:

  1. Once you collect all the loot, leave the Dungeon.
  2. Then, open the World Map and expand the journal by clicking the arrow to the right.
  3. Click on the button labeled “Reset Dungeons” at the bottom of the Journal.
  4. Then, click on “Accept” in the pop-up box.
  5. Once you reset it, interact with the Dungeon’s entrance to go in.

When you enter the Dungeon again, you’ll find all the enemies and the loot again. Keep in mind that this method works only on a select few Dungeons and their Nightmare versions. It will not work on Campaign Dungeons and Strongholds.

While entering the reset Dungeons, make sure you have replenished your health. The enemies will respawn as well along with the loot. Moreover, there is a chance that you will come across the Butcher enemy in one such dungeon. It’s a little tough to put him down so make sure you are at your best.
